Facebook testing tool that allows users transfer pics to Google Photos

Facebook started testing a tool on Monday that lets users move their images more easily to other online services, as it faces pressure from regulators to loosen its grip on data.

The social network's new tool will allow people to transfer their photos and videos directly to competing platforms, starting with Google Photos.

Indian-origin worker at US pharmacy convicted for illegally selling opioid

A 27-year-old Indian-origin man has been convicted for conspiring to distribute an opioid pain medication outside the usual course of professional practice and without any legal medical purpose.

Anmol Singh Kamra of Philadelphia, a pharmacy technician conspired with George Fisher, a physician, and Frank Brown, both charged separately, to illegally distribute thousands of oxycodone pills to people suffering from addiction.

Lack of marquee investors, fear of RBI refusal hit YES Bank shares, bonds

Lack of marquee investors and fear that the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) will not clear the investments by the new investors hit the share price of YES Bank on Monday. The bank's stock closed 6.2 per cent down at Rs 64 a share. The bank's dollar bonds due in February 2023 also fell the most in two months.

On Friday evening, the bank had announced that its board had agreed to raise $2 billion from an assortment of investors. Of this, $1.2 billion will come from Canada-based businessman Erwin Singh Braich and SPGP Holdings. The second big investment was coming from CITAX Holdings.

Eicher Motors shares dip 5% on disappointing November sales data

Shares of Eicher Motors dipped 5 per cent to Rs 21,853 intra-day on BSE on Monday as investors booked profit after the company reported disappointing motorcycle sales in November 2019.

The company that manufactures the iconic Royal Enfield (RE) brand of motorcycles which leads the premium motorcycle segment in India recorded 8 per cent drop in total two-wheeler sales at 60,411 units in November 2019.

Sluggish scooter biz drags TVS Motor's domestic two-wheeler sales down 27%

TVS Motor has reported a 26.52 per cent drop in domestic two-wheeler sales during November, to 191,222 units from 260,253 units the same month a year ago, owing to huge pressure is its scooter segment.

The company has attributed the decline to the advancing of the Diwali season by a month and the planned adjustment of BS IV stocks.

Bajaj Auto reports a slight dip in November sales at 403,223 units

Bajaj Auto on Monday reported a marginal dip of 0.9 per cent in total sales at 403,223 units in November this year.

The company had sold 406,930 units in the same month a year-ago.

Tech, service firms gear up for FASTag as govt extends deadline to Dec 15

While the transport ministry has given a two-week extension to the roll-out of electronic toll collection - FASTags - across the national highways, tech companies and service providers are all set to switch to this mechanism.

Several tech companies said sales of FASTags have almost tripled in the last few days. Service providers have also bolstered their backend tech to tackle any sort of lag caused by surge in usage of these at toll booths.

Rahul Bajaj criticism can hurt national interest: FM Nirmala Sitharaman

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man said the statement by Rahul Bajaj, chairman of Bajaj Group, on Saturday that India Inc was afraid of criticising the Narendra Modi government can hurt national interest, if it gains traction.

The Home Minister Amit Shah answers on how issues raised by Bajaj were addressed. Questions/criticisms are heard and answered/addressed. Always a better way to seek an answer than spreading one's own impressions, which, on gaining traction, can hurt national interest, Sitharaman said on Twitter.

NSE suspends Karvy Stock Broking's license due to non-compliance

National Stock Exchange (NSE) on Monday suspended the license of Karvy Stock Broking with effect from today (December 2, 2019) due to non-compliance of the regulatory provisions of the Exchange.

In a circular, the exchange informed that the brokerage firm has been suspended from capital market, Futures & Options (F&O), Currency derivatives, Debt, Mutual Fund Service System (MFSS) and commodity derivatives segments.
